Course Outline

Introduction

Configuring the Kubernetes Cluster

Kubernetes Infrastructure

  • Resource provisioning, partitioning, and networking setup
  • Key considerations for scaling a Kubernetes Cluster

Ensuring High-Availability

  • Strategies for Load Balancing and Service Discovery

Deploying Scalable Applications

  • Implementing Horizontal Pod Autoscaling
  • Clustering databases within Kubernetes

Application Security

  • Managing Authentication
  • Configuring Authorization

Application Updates

  • Handling Package Management
  • Managing releases in Kubernetes

Maintenance

  • Logging via Fluentd (optional)
  • Monitoring using the Elastic Stack (ELK) (optional)
  • Job scheduling with Cronjob

Troubleshooting

  • Identifying and resolving common Kubernetes issues

Summary and Conclusion

Requirements

  • Practical experience with Docker containers
  • Proficiency with the Linux command line interface
  • A solid grasp of core networking concepts

Target Audience

  • Software developers
  • System and software architects
  • Deployment engineers
